    Tissue specific membrane association of α1T, a truncated form of the α1 subunit of the Na pump

    Get PDF
    AbstractWe have assessed the Na pump α-subunit isoform content utilizing site directed antibodies in two vascular smooth muscle (VSM) preparations known to contain functional Na pump sites, VSM microsomal fractions (Na+,K+-ATPase) and intact primary confluent cells (ouabain inhibited 86Rb uptake). A comparison of isoform content was made with kidney microsomes. Both VSM and kidney microsomes contained a full length α1 subunit (~100 kDa) as well as a truncated subunit, α1T (~66 kDa). SDS treatment of VSM microsomes effected an increase in Na+,K+-ATPase and a retention of α1T. SDS treated kidney microsomes retained the α1 isoform and Na+,K+-ATPase. Confluent VSM cells showed no detectable α1T, only α1T. In the absence of detectable full length α1, the α1T protein may represent a functional Na pump component in canine VSM
